Kinds of Windows and Doors

Birmingham offers a vast array of doors and window choices to fit various requirements and choices. Here are some of the most popular types:

Windows:

  • Double-Hung Windows: These windows have two sashes that move up and down, enabling easy ventilation and cleaning.
  • Sash Windows: Operated by a crank, these windows swing outside, providing excellent air flow and a streamlined, contemporary appearance.
  • Sliding Windows: These windows slide horizontally, making them ideal for areas with minimal opening space.
  • Bay and Bow Windows: These multi-pane windows job external, creating extra interior space and a panoramic view.
  • Picture Windows: Large, fixed windows that offer unobstructed views and ample natural light.

Doors:

  • Entry Doors: Available in a range of materials such as wood, steel, and fiberglass, entry doors are the first point of contact for visitors and can considerably affect your home's curb appeal.
  • French Doors: These doors include several glass panes and can be utilized for both entry and interior areas, providing a traditional and stylish look.
  • Sliding Doors: Ideal for patio areas and decks, moving doors use simple access and a smooth transition between indoor and outside spaces.
  • Bi-Fold Doors: These doors fold back onto themselves, producing a large, open space and a contemporary, contemporary feel.

Aspects to Consider When Choosing Windows and Doors

When picking doors and windows for your Birmingham home, consider the list below elements:

  • Material: Common materials include wood, vinyl, aluminum, and composite. Each has its own benefits in regards to durability, upkeep, and cost.
  • Energy Efficiency: Look for windows and doors with high energy rankings, such as those accredited by the Energy Star program. Functions like double or triple glazing, low-E coatings, and gas fills can enhance energy performance.
  • Design and style: Choose doors and windows that complement your home's architectural design and interior style. Consider the size, shape, and color to guarantee a cohesive appearance.
  • Budget plan: Determine your budget plan and explore choices that use the very best value for your cash. High-quality items might have a higher upfront cost however can conserve you money in the long run through energy savings and lowered upkeep.
  • Installation: Proper setup is crucial for the performance and longevity of your windows and doors. Consider hiring an expert installer to guarantee a seamless and safe fit.

FAQs

Q: What are the most energy-efficient window materials?A: Double-pane or triple-pane windows with low-E finishes and gas fills are among the most energy-efficient. Materials like vinyl and fiberglass likewise use excellent insulation residential or commercial properties.

Q: How can I enhance the security of my windows and doors?A: Install durable locks, use shatter-resistant glass, and think about including security film or bars for included protection. Frequently examine and maintain your locks and hinges to ensure they remain in good working condition.

Q: What is the average lifespan of windows and doors?A: High-quality doors and windows can last 20-30 years or more with appropriate maintenance. Aspects such as material, environment, and usage can impact their lifespan.
